> Process to connect to internet using IBM Thinkpad T42, Fedora 8 KDE, 
> and Cingular/AT&T 8525 (HTC) smartphone running WM6
>
> Documents used:
>
> http://www.gentoo.org/doc/en/bluetooth-guide.xml
> http://www.thinkwiki.org/wiki/How_to_setup_Bluetooth
> Linux kernel source tree (>=2.6.22) under Documentation/thinkpad_acpi.txt
> http://www.linuxdevcenter.com/pub/a/linux/2006/09/21/rediscovering-bluetooth.html?page=last 
>
>
> Make sure that all the bluetooth programs are installed: 
> kdebluetooth-libs, bluez-libs, kdebluetooth, bluez-utils, 
> kmobiletools, bluez-hcidump, bluez-libs-devel, kdebluetooth-devel, and 
> dependencies.
>
> Set up bluetooth operation per the thinkpad-acpi.txt documentation. 
> The default acpi-mask does not allow for Fn-F5 to turn on/off bluetooth.
>
> Put these files in make life easier using a root shell:
>
> /etc/acpi/actions/bluetooth.sh (permissions 755):
>
> #!/bin/bash
> #
> # Bluetooth on/off control
> #
> if [ -e /tmp/bluetooth ]
> then
> echo enable > /proc/acpi/ibm/bluetooth
> touch /tmp/bluetooth
> else
> echo disable > /proc/acpi/ibm/bluetooth
> rm /tmp/bluetooth
> fi
>
> /etc/acpi/events/bluetooth.conf (permissions 744):
>
> #
> # Bluetooth control
> #
>
> event=ibm/hotkey HKEY 00000080 00001005
> action=/etc/acpi/actions/bluetooth.sh
>
> I also forced /sys/devices/platform/thinkpad_acpi/hotkey_mask equal to 
> /sys/devices/platform/thinkpad_acpi/hotkey_bios_mask. This allows 
> fn-F5 to toggle bluetooth on/off and has the added benefit of turning 
> off the gray button display box in the center of the screen when you 
> hit a hotkey. The setup is done by editing /etc/rc.d/init.d/acpid 
> under the "start", "restart", and "condrestart" section with the 
> following line:
>
> cat /sys/devices/platform/thinkpad_acpi/hotkey_bios_mask > 
> /sys/devices/platform/thinkpad_acpi/hotkey_mask
>
> This line is inserted before the ";;" line in each of the above 
> mentioned sections.
>
> I also created a read-only file /etc/bluetooth/pin with my pin number. 
> I also edited /etc/bluetooth/hcid.conf "passkey" to be the same number 
> as in /etc/bluetooth/pin.
>
> After the above changes, you can restart acpid to update its operation.
>
> Start kbluetooth. Turn on bluetooth on the Thinkpad and on the 
> smartphone. Don't forget to make the smartphone discoverable and the 
> laptop discoverable.
>
> In the same root shell, do an "hcitool scan" to find the hardware id 
> of the smartphone. For the rest of this document, we will call the 
> hardware ID of the smartphone xx:xx:xx:xx:xx:xx. We will need this ID 
> number later to do the pairing.
>
> Now on the smartphone, go to "Internet Sharing" and set it up for 
> "Bluetooth PAN" and "MEdia Net". Hit "connect" and let the phone 
> register itself to the cellular network. When the phone indicates that 
> the network connection is complete, you can continue on.
>
> Now enter the command "sdptool add NAP". This allows the service to be 
> used. The following command "pand --role PANU --service NAP --connect 
> xx:xx:xx:xx:xx:xx" will do a couple of things: 1) Allow for pairing, 
> and 2) set up the data connection. You will be asked for the PIN 
> numbers on both the smartphone and laptop. Enter the appropriate 
> numbers and this will complete the pairing. Both the smartphone and 
> the laptop should remember the pairing for future use. Once the 
> pairing is done, turn off discovery on both the laptop and the 
> smartphone as it will not be necessary unless you break the pairing.
>
> After completing the pairing, you need to give the created interface 
> an address. I use "ifconfig bnep0 192.168.1.1". Now that the laptop is 
> given an address, we need to get the rest of the needed routing 
> information. Issue the command "dhclient bnep0" and that should get 
> you on the air and running when the command prompt returns.
>
> To disconnect the connection, just go to "Internet Sharing" and 
> disconnect. The pairing will drop and you will be disconnected from 
> the internet.
>
> A warning to the wise - You had better have the unlimited internet 
> package or expect a huge bill. You can also power the smartphone from 
> the laptop via USB by making sure that START > SETTINGS > USB to PC 
> has the advanced network functionality option not selected. This will 
> save the battery in the smartphone.
>
> This process may work for other combinations but the process should be 
> pretty much the same.
